1. Booking Without Researching the Location

Siquijor is small but spread out, and not all hotels are situated conveniently. Many tourists book hotels which are removed from the main attractions like Paliton Beach, Cambugahay Falls, or the town of San Juan, which is the hub for many resorts and restaurants. In case you’re not careful, you can end up in a distant area with limited transportation options. Always check the space out of your hotel to the places you plan to visit and ensure it’s in or near a well-connected area.

2. Ignoring Transportation Availability

Unlike more developed islands, Siquijor has limited public transport options. In case you book a hotel removed from the ferry terminal or most important roads without considering learn how to get round, you might find yourself stranded or counting on costly tricycle rides. Some lodging provide transport services, so inquire about shuttle options or motorbike leases before finalizing your booking.

4. Not Checking Air Conditioning and Power Backup

Power interruptions are relatively common in Siquijor, particularly during storms or peak seasons. Not all accommodations have backup generators, and some budget stays could not offer air conditioning. In the event you’re sensitive to heat or can’t do without electricity, make certain to check if your chosen hotel has a reliable energy backup system and proper cooling options.

8. Assuming All Hotels Settle for Credit Cards

Cash is king in Siquijor. Many hotels, especially family-run inns and beachentrance cottages, operate on a money-only basis. Even those that advertise card payments might have machines which might be usually offline. Bring sufficient Philippine pesos to cover your keep and different expenses, as ATMs are limited and generally unreliable.
